CURRENT BILL SUMMARY
SB 1085 - This act requires the governing board of each public institution of higher education in Missouri to engage in discussions with law enforcement agencies and enter into a memorandum of understanding (MOU) concerning sexual assault, domestic violence, dating violence, and stalking involving students on and off campus.
The MOU must contain detailed policies and protocols regarding sexual assault, domestic violence, dating violence, and stalking involving students that comports with the best and current professional practices, and set out the procedural requirements for the reporting of an offense, protocol for establishing jurisdiction, and criteria for determining when an offense must be reported to law enforcement.
This act is identical to HB 1678 (2016) and to a provision contained in CCS/SCS/SB 921 (2016), HCS/HB 1930 (2016), HB 1972 (2016), and HCS/SS/SCS/SB 663 (2016).
